Significance
Two days earlier, India’s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) announced a seemingly key development regarding the India-China border stand-off in the western Himalayas that began in 2020: an agreement on “patrolling arrangements along the Line of Actual Control”.
Impacts
- Joint ventures with the Indian side holding a majority stake will increase in Indian sectors Delhi deems non-sensitive.
- Indian imports of Chinese components will rise.
- The two countries will try to intensify efforts to settle wider border issues.
